Hi Everyone,

There are a lot of threads discussing the use of Clomid on cycle, but I was wondering what everyone's thoughts are running Clomid with an 8 week PH cycle.

I previously ran a 1-andro cycle at 130mg a day and (although under dosed) I noticed some suppression at week 3 of the 4 week cycle. I did however not run a test base alongside it.

I plan on starting a new cycle of 1-andro at 330mg/day along with 4-andro at 330mg/day for 8 weeks starting on November 1st. I just received my Clomid and I have enough for PCT and to run along with the 8 week cycle.

I was planning on running Clomid every other day while on cycle at 25mg. Then on PCT bump it to 50mg everyday for a week followed by 25mg for the final 3 weeks of the PCT.

If it is recommended to run Clomid on cycle at what dose and how frequent do you recommend (e.g, everyday or once I notice suppression)?

I also plan on running laxogenin @175mg/day, arimistane @250mg/day, and epiandostenolone 100mg/day with my PCT.

I already have all the items, I just want to plan this out best I can before I start.

I know there are people on here who think otherwise but I'm not a believer in clomid on cycle. The role of clomid is to get your natural test levels firing on all cylinders and bring back homeostasis.

If your giving your body artificial forms of test then that is why your natural test shuts down because it thinks it doesn't need it. Adding in clomid will just confuse the body further. It will think you have enough test yet your sending signals to boost natural test and I think this will be more likely to result in conversion of test to estrogen etc. as your body tries to make sense of the mixed signals.

Remember a true test base is still artificial, and will continue to shut down natural test. Even test will shut down test. The idea is to reduce the side effects of low natural test because a lot of hormones will act like test in the body but will kill libido, energy levels etc. So the test base should help combat these but will not prevent the need to pct after cycle.

If you've ran clomid during your cycle where do you go for pct? Are you gonna just stop the andros and hope your body uses the clomid to return to normal levels or try switching to nolva, possibly whilst continuing the clomid? Either way I think your just over complicating things.
